(Re)Thinking Violence in Health Care Settings: A Critical Approach
Trudy Rudge
Drawing together the latest research from Australia, Canada, the UK, and the US, (Re) Thinking Violence in Health Care Settings engages with the work of critical theorists such as Bourdieu, Butler, Foucault, Latour, and Zizek, amongst others, to address the issue of violence and theorise its workings in creative and controversial ways.
